Transaction 03e66a4ca1ae319f5752401b551740f655112a4472244a92016f44ac6f98e3de
1 Input
2 Outputs
- 03e66a4ca1ae319f5752401b551740f655112a4472244a92016f44ac6f98e3de:0
- 03e66a4ca1ae319f5752401b551740f655112a4472244a92016f44ac6f98e3de:1
value 23596
address 198bigwSusbzX1xeymx4mB1BUuGxcutbxH
value 2521143
address 1LE91prZwHurun8TcYAEKJxTTykHcLjyCy